Juan I. Castrillo is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biomedical Engineering and Food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Juan I. Castrillo has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 697 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 4 papers in Food Science. Recurrent topics in Juan I. Castrillo’s work include Fungal and yeast genetics research (13 papers), Metabolic Engineering and Synthetic Biology (10 papers) and Biofuel production and bioconversion (6 papers). Juan I. Castrillo is often cited by papers focused on Fungal and yeast genetics research (13 papers), Metabolic Engineering and Synthetic Biology (10 papers) and Biofuel production and bioconversion (6 papers). Juan I. Castrillo coll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, The Netherlands and Spain. Juan I. Castrillo's co-authors include Stephen G. Oliver, Johannes P. van Dijken, Ruud A. Weusthuis, Andrew Hayes and Craig Ritchie and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Microbiology and Biotechnology, Phytochemistry and BMC Bioinformatics.
